Hoodlums attack Oyetola’s wife’s convoy in Osun

Suspected hoodlums have attacked the convoy of Osun State Governor’s wife, Kafayat Oyetola, injuring some security operatives.

It was gathered that the convoy of the governor’s wife was attacked at about 8 p.m. on Friday at Owode-Ede in Ede South Local Government Area of Osun State.

The incident was said to have caused panic in the area after the security operatives attached to the to convoy engaged the assailants in shootout.

It was learnt that security operatives shot severally to the air to disperse the hoodlums who were hauling stones and other dangerous weapons at the Osun First Lady’s convoy.

An eyewitness disclosed that some of the security operatives were injured, adding that they shattered the glasses of the vehicles.

The incident was confirmed by the media aide of the governor’s wife, Iluyomade Oluwatumise.

She, however, failed to disclose the number of security aides injured.
